The Metric System (International System of Units - SI)
The metric system, officially known as the International System of Units (SI), is a decimal system based on powers of 10. Its simplicity and logical structure make it the preferred system for scientific and technological applications worldwide. Key units include:
- Meter (m): The base unit of length.
- Gram (g): The base unit of mass.
- Liter (l): The base unit of volume.
- Second (s): The base unit of time.
The metric system's prefixes, such as kilo (1000), centi (1/100), and milli (1/1000), allow for easy conversion between units. For instance, 1 kilometer is equal to 1000 meters, and 1 milliliter is equal to 1/1000 of a liter. This consistency significantly reduces the potential for errors in calculations.

The Conversion: 1/2 Inch to Millimeters
Now, let's address the core question: how many millimeters are in 1/2 inch?
The exact conversion factor is 25.4 millimeters per inch. Therefore, to convert 1/2 inch to millimeters, we simply perform the following calculation:
0.5 inches * 25.4 mm/inch = 12.7 mm
Thus, there are 12.7 millimeters in 1/2 inch.

Historical Context of Measurement Systems
The existence of two major measurement systems, metric and imperial, reflects a historical evolution. The metric system emerged from a desire for a standardized, universally understood system, whereas the imperial system evolved organically over time.
The metric system's development was spearheaded by the French Academy of Sciences in the late 18th century, aiming for a rational and coherent system based on decimal multiples. Its adoption was gradual, but it eventually became the dominant system globally due to its inherent simplicity and ease of use in scientific and technical fields.
The imperial system, on the other hand, is a legacy of historical units that developed independently across various regions and cultures. The lack of a coherent structure makes it less efficient for complex calculations and conversions.
